Do You Know ADSOEF? What’s Available for You?

 

Alpha Delta State Ohio Educational Foundation supports members by offering the following opportunities.

 

❖ Scholarships

  1. Margaret L. White Scholarship at OSU
  2. Ruth Grimes Scholarship at Miami University
  3. Florence L. Woodward Scholarship at Kent State University
  4. Annie Webb Blanton Scholarship at any accredited university


❖ A. Margaret Boyd International Study fellowships for members to study abroad


 Leadership awards


 Educational Project awards


  Lifelong Learning awards


Check out the ADSOEF website at adsoef.org.  Click on Applications and Forms and find directions and applications for all of the opportunities listed above.  Click on Educational Opportunities for descriptions.  Contact ADSOEF board members with your questions.

CIRCUITS FOR STEM EDUCATION

HOCKING HILLS CHILDREN'S MUSEUM


The Educational Services Committee is excited to share the final grant report from the latest Individual/Classroom/Community Project to be completed. Kristen Stimmel, Alpha Xi, and her colleagues applied for the funds to purchase STEM coding and building circuit kits for the Hocking Hills Children’s Museum. This exciting venture will be opening soon with these Snap Circuit kits at one station. Please read Kristen’s report.


Circuits for STEM Education


The Hocking Hills Children’s Museum is passionate about providing hands-on educational opportunities for the children in our community as well as the many visitors that visit our region.  As a group of early childhood educators in a rural community, our board saw a need to support the learning of our youth by engaging them in play as well as give parents the opportunity and resources to be part of their child’s learning.


By creating a Snap Circuit exhibit the museum hopes to bring science, technology, engineering, and math concepts to life through hands-on activities.  With STEM learning becoming more and more popular in school curriculums we also hope to support and enhance the learning of our nearby schools as well as become a destination for school visits.  We hope to continue to grow as a place of learning and fun for our community.  In the future we plan to create more STEM based learning exhibits to engage and support our community!
